Montego Bay is one of Jamaica’s easiest entry points for cannabis-curious visitors—but the best choices are not random beach sellers or ordinary nightlife venues.
Start with a regulated herb house where staff can explain current visitor requirements and products. Then add a pre-booked farm or cultural tour if you want to understand how ganja is grown and why it matters in Jamaican life.

A small guided farm stop can add cultivation knowledge, Jamaican history and personal cultural context to a Montego Bay stay.
A good guide should explain the plant’s life cycle, traditional uses and the difference between a licensed commercial operation and an informal local grow.

Visit a licensed herb house with government photo ID. Ask about visitor access, potency and the approved place to consume.
Take a pre-booked cultural or farm visit in the hills. Focus on cultivation, history and respectful conversation.
Return to the Hip Strip for food, sea views or sunset. Keep cannabis put away unless the venue expressly permits it.
